Those inputs , before I forget , are USB - snow to USB - A ( for agitate or turning it into a USB DAC ) , along with a 2.5 mm balance out , 3.5 millimetre out / line - out / coaxial out and a 4.4 mm balanced / line output . The M11S only number in pitch-black .

equip with two ESS ES9038Q2H DACs to cover the right and leftover TV channel , the M11S apply FiiO ’s 4thGen FPGA ( Field Programmable Gate Arrays ) with form - locked closed circuit technology . Some digging on-line infers the circuit constantly adjusts to oppose the frequency of the input signal signal it is receiving .

And working in alignment with dual custom femtosecond crystal oscillators , the idea is this set - up offer “ elevated precision ” and low jitter ( digital audio errors ) to produce a sporty audio frequency carrying into action . Indian file support is up to 32 - bit/384kHz and DSD256 , and there are three levels of gain to pick out from low , average , and high : depending on a headphone ’s electrical resistance .

The player comes with 3 GB of RAM and Qualcomm ’s Snapdragon 660 chipset . That ’s a mid - range chip from a few year ago , tantamount to what ’s in theXiaomi Redmi Note 7orSamsung Galaxy A9 .

32 GB of internal storage is leave but that can be extend with microSD cards up to 2 TB . The 1300mAH barrage claim to offer 14 hours of service before recharging . Streaming a play list fromAmazon Musicfor an hour at 50 % mass take the electric battery life down by 7 % and that ’s on target for the 14 - hour total . Should you up the volume the overall battery life will strike to less than that .

Other feature film let in full unfolding ofMQA filesfor honorable quality carrying into action . The Global SRC bypass overrides Android ’s Sample Rate Conversion for routine - perfect playback , and there ’s Roon Ready support as well .

Bluetooth 5.0is include with the M11S able to get SBC , AAC , and LDAC codecs , as well as channelize those codecs along withaptX , aptX HD , LDACand LHDC for higher quality wireless playback . There ’s also Wi - Fi in the form of 2.4 and 5GHz connectivity .

FAQs

The FiiO M11S plump for an extensive list of formats , that include up to DSD256 , 24 - bit/352.8 K DXD , APE format up to 24 - bit/384kHz , Apple Lossless up to 32 - bit/384kHz , AIFF , FLAC , and WAV up to 32 - bit/384kHz , WMA Lossless up to 24 - bit/192kHz , as well as MQA , MP3 , OGG , and AAC .
